Dave McDonnell’s 5th World album Mammals is a robust and groovy dialogue between the digital and the organic. Working with Chicago drummer Quinlan Kirchner (Wild Belle) McDonnell lays down driving, multi layered sequencer patterns and ambient textures, created with a text-based music coding software called RTcmix.
Over these backing tracks Kirchner drums: sometimes repetitive and krautrock, then polyrhythmic and afro-beat inspired, and again with moments of full-on kinetic rock abandon. Once these excursions were edited into song structures, the resulting pieces were finished off with haunting vocal harmonies from Emma-Louise Yohanan (Icy Demons) and bass work from Derek Almstead (Of Montreal).
McDonnell adds his own vocals, along with low, monk like, contra-alto clarinet drones and pulses, heavily processed saxophone and ripping analogue synth leads. The result is a music that owes as much stylistically to the work of electronic pioneer Jon Hassell as it does to Aphex Twin and Holly Herndon.
